If your uPVC window doesn't close properly, it may be due to a gap between the frame and the sash. This could cause draughts, but it can also cause damp and water damage. To check this, try putting a piece paper between the sash and the frame to see if it can be sealed.

To repair it, you'll have to take off the seals around the frame and the sash. You'll then have to remove the locking mechanism from its place inside the frame. This will require the help of a tool such as a flat screwdriver and a torch to reach the gearbox. After you have removed the gearbox, you'll need to replace it with a brand new one that is the same model and size.

The condensation of water between the glass panes is a common issue with double-glazed UPVC Windows. This is usually the result of window frames aren't fitted correctly or if the nail fins have become loose and are not providing a good seal. A uPVC repair expert will replace the seals and ensure that the window is well sealed which will prevent drafts and improve efficiency in energy use.
